Many churches, meetings, peace groups and individuals raise support for the work of CPT in diverse and creative ways.  We dedicate this corner to those stories, both as a way to say “Thank You!” and as an inspiration to others.  Please send your friend-raising stories to kryss@cpt.org.

The Mennonite Church and the Muslim community of Floradale, Ontario produced a dinner theatre featuring a traditional Middle Eastern meal and the play “Those Shoes of Peace,” a story of a CPTer’s peacemaking in Palestine and return home to North America where he faces opposition from his family.  Proceeds were divided between CPT and the church’s Palestinian Refugee Committee. CPT received $4857!
